Magnetic transition induced by mechanical deformation in Fe60Al40−xSix ternary alloys
چکیده انگلیسی

We have used Mössbauer spectroscopy and X-ray diffraction to study the influence of different Al/Si ratios on the structural and magnetic properties of the mechanically deformed Fe60Al40−xSix alloys. The results indicate that ternary alloys also present the magnetic transition with disordering observed in binary Fe60Al40 alloys. Besides, Si introduction has two opposite contributions. From a structural point of view, hinders the disordering process, but, from a magnetic point of view promotes the magnetic transition.


• Fe60Al40−xSix alloys were disordered by means of planetary ball milling technique.
• Paramagnetic to ferromagnetic transition is observed with disordering.
• Si addition hinders the disordering process and the increase of the lattice parameter.
• Si addition promotes the paramagnetic to ferromagnetic transition.
